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Информат.Лек.фр.doc
Скачиваний:
12
Добавлен:
10.11.2019
Размер:
5.51 Mб
Скачать

23.5.1.Создание таблиц базы данных Под созданием базы данных подразумевается создание системы связанных таблиц с именами и заголовками полей, со значениями атрибутов в полях.

После запуска программы MS Access следует выполнить одну из операций:

щелкнуть по кнопке Создать на панели инструментов;

нажать комбинации клавиш Ctrl + N;

выполнить команды главного меню Файл – Создать;

  • в появившемся дополнительном окне Создание файла (справа на экране), выбрать ярлык или строку Новая база данных и щелкнуть по нему;

  • в раскрывшемся окне Файл новой базы данных, в поле Имя файла, расположенном в нижней части окна, указать место размещения файла (путь) и его имя;

  • щелкнуть по кнопке Создать, расположенной справа от этой строки;

  • в левой части раскрывшегося окна База данных с именем создаваемой базы данных представляется список объектов (Таблицы, Запросы, Формы, Отчеты, Страницы, Макросы, Модули, Группы избранное), из которых по умолчанию выделяется объект Таблицы, а в правой части окна представляются способы создания таблиц (Создание таблицы в режиме конструктора, Создание таблицы с помощью мастера, Создание таблицы путем ввода данных). Из списка предлагаемых способов создания таблиц следует выбрать желаемый способ.

Самостоятельное создание таблиц базы данных

Для самостоятельного создания базы данных необходимо дважды щелкнуть по ярлыку против строки Создание таблицы путем ввода данных. Вследствие этого на экране появится окно в виде пустой таблицы с заголовками: Поле1, Поле2, …, Поле10. После этого следует в верхние ячейки этих полей поместить заголовки, а в последующие ячейки – значения. Таким способом создаются все таблицы базы данных. Однако этот способ требует много времени и напряжения.

Процесс создания базы данных значительно облегчается при использовании мастера таблиц. Работа с мастером таблиц предусматривает создание таблиц за несколько шагов.

Создание таблиц базы данных с помощью мастера таблиц

На первом шаге создается таблица по одному из образцов, предложенных мастером таблиц. При этом мастер таблиц предлагает 25 вариантов таблиц делового применения (Контакты, Сотрудники, Задачи, Студенты и др.) и 20 вариантов таблиц личного пользования (Адреса, Рецепты, Альбомы и др.).

Первый шаг.

  • В раскрывшемся окне База данных необходимо дважды щелкнуть по строке Создание таблицы с помощью мастера или по ярлыку перед этой строкой;

  • в раскрывшемся окне Создание таблиц изображаются два поля категорий таблиц: деловые и личные, а также три дополнительных окна с названиями: Образцы таблиц, Образцы полей и Поля новой таблицы. В этом окне следует выбрать категорию таблиц с помощью переключателя. Из списка в дополнительном окне Образцы таблиц следует выделить строку с подходящим названием таблицы, суть которой ближе всего отображает содержание создаваемой таблицы, и щелкнуть по ней;

  • в появившемся списке в окне Образцы полей необходимо выделить строку с подходящим названием поля и щелкнуть по кнопке >. После этого выбранное название поля отобразится в окне Поля новой таблицы. Таким способом можно расположить в этом окне и другие названия выбранных полей.

Если какое–либо название поля необходимо исключить из окна Поля новой таблицы, то его следует выделить, а затем щелкнуть по кнопке < . Для отображения всего списка названий полей окна Образцы полей в окне Поля новой таблицы следует щелкнуть по кнопке >> , а для исключения всех полей из списка Поля новой таблицы следует щелкнуть по кнопке <<.

При необходимости переименования названия поля в списке Поля новой таблицы следует выделить это название и щелкнуть по кнопке Переименовать поле... и в открывшейся строке ввести новое название поля.

После завершения формирования названий полей следует щелкнуть по кнопке Далее в окне Создание таблиц.

Этой операцией завершается первый шаг работы мастера таблиц и осуществляется переход ко второму шагу.

В окне второго шага задается имя для создаваемой таблицы и выбирается способ задания первичного ключа.

Второй шаг.

В раскрывшемся окне второго шага следует:

  • в имеющейся строке с названием Задайте имя для новой рассылки установить имя создаваемой таблицы;

  • выбрать способ установки первичного ключа (автоматически, самим пользователем).

Способ установки первичного ключа в режиме автоматически выбирается тогда, когда пользователь затрудняется самостоятельно сделать этот выбор. В таком случае мастер таблиц делает это сам. Если пользователь определился с полем первичного ключа еще на стадии проектирования базы данных, то ему следует выбирать вариант установки первичного ключа самим пользователем.

  • После выбора варианта следует щелкнуть по кнопке Далее этого окна.

При выборе второго варианта задания первичного ключа раскрывается диалоговое окно с названием Создание таблиц. В верхней части этого окна изображена строка с названием Выберите поле с уникальными для каждой записи данными. Эта строка содержит раскрывающийся список названий полей создаваемой таблицы, выбранных на предыдущем этапе.

  • Из раскрывающегося списка необходимо выбрать название поля, которое будет выполнять функцию первичного ключа из трех, представленных в этом окне вариантов:

последовательные числа, автоматически присваиваемые

каждой новой записи,

числа, вводимые пользователем при добавлении новой записи,

сочетание чисел и букв, вводимое пользователем при добавлении

новых записей.

  • щелкнуть по кнопке Далее этого окна.

Третий шаг.

Он выполняется, если в базе данных уже существуют ранее созданные другие таблицы, если таковых нет, то он прпускаетя автоматически, преходя на следующий шаг.

При выполнении третьего шага раскрывается очередное окно, в котором мастер задает вопрос:

Связана ли новая таблица с другими таблицами базы?.

Одновременно формируется список с названиями ранее созданных таблиц. Для каждой из них будет показано отсутствие связи с новой таблицей. Если одна из уже созданных таблиц должна находиться с вновь создаваемой таблицей в связи один ко многим, то ее название нужно выделить и щелкнуть по кнопке Связи.

В новом раскрывшемся окне путем выбора нужного переключателя уточнить характер связи и щелкнуть по кнопке ОК этого окна.

Четвертый шаг.

В раскрывшемся окне с названием Создание таблиц мастер предлагает три варианта дальнейших действий:

  • изменить структуру,

  • ввести данные непосредственно в таблицу (устанавливается по умолчанию),

  • ввести данные в таблицу с помощью формы, создаваемой мастером.

Далее следует выбрать нужный вариант и щелкнуть по кнопке Готово этого окна. При этом на экране появится новая (пустая) таблица, в которую можно вводить данные.

В случае выбора первого варианта происходит переключение в режим Конструктор, в котором в произвольной форме можно изменить структуру созданной таблицы.

При выборе второго варианта происходит переключение в режим Таблица. Это позволяет вводить необходимые данные непосредственно в ячейки ее полей.

В третьем случае мастер автоматически создаст форму удобную для ввода данных в таблицу.

Очевидно, что при создании первой таблицы, третий шаг мастера исключается.